UAAP Season 65 is the 2002–2003 season of the University Athletic Association of the Philippines, which was hosted by National University.[1]

NCAA Season 78

NCAA Season 78 is the 2002–03 season of the National Collegiate Athletic Association (Philippines), which was hosted by San Beda College, The season opened on June 29, 2002, at the Araneta Coliseum. UAAP Season 65 and NCAA Season 78 are 2002 in Philippine sport.

University Athletic Association of the Philippines

The University Athletic Association of the Philippines (UAAP), established in 1938, is an athletic association of eight Metro Manila universities in the Philippines.
